Development and validation of a multivariable genotype-informed gestational diabetes prediction algorithm for clinical use in the Mexican population: insights into susceptibility mechanisms.

Mirella ZuluetaHéctor Gallardo-RincónLuis Alberto Martinez-JuarezJulieta Lomelin-GasconJaninne Ortega-MontielAlejandra MontoyaLeire MendizabalMaddi ArregiMaría de Los Angeles Martinez-MartinezEneida Del Socorro Camarillo RomeroHugo Mendieta ZerónJosé de Jesús Garduño GarcíaLaureano SimónRoberto Tapia-Conyer
Published in: BMJ open diabetes research & care (2023)
We developed a predictive model using both genetic and clinical factors to identify Mexican women at risk of developing GDM. These findings may contribute to a greater understanding of metabolic functions that underlie elevated GDM risk and support personalized patient recommendations.
